As an owner and operator of family communities for generations, Roberts Resorts & Communities has become industry leader in delivering quality, affordable homes in safe, private communities for everyday families and retirees. With a track record of over 40 years, founder R.C. Roberts created a unique portfolio and today, these manufactured home communities, and award-winning RV resorts continue to grow across Alabama, Arizona, California, Colorado, Texas, and Utah. Now under second generation, Scott Roberts, the Roberts company continues to create exceptional places where people come to unwind during seasonal RV vacations and live the dream at year-round destinations in attainable and beautiful manufactured homes.

WHAT YOU’LL DO…

  • Greet & establish a rapport with guests, residents, prospective residents, and vendors 
  • Answer calls efficiently for reservations and calls customers when needed 
  • Answers questions in our online chat 
  • Report resort comments, suggestions, and complaints to the Resort Manager 
  • Efficiently check guests in and out, handling reservations and walk-in guests 
  • Collect rent, deposits, and payments for other services in Rent Manager and Campspot 
  • Make collection calls for site rental payments as directed 
  • Send emails to residents / potential guests as needed 
  • Maintain and complete resort files, reports, and records 
  • Upload files resident files and resident/guest communications to Rent Manager 
  • Prepare and distribute resort communications such as newsletters, rule reminders, violations etc. 
  • Ensure office supplies are sufficiently stocked and prepare orders as needed 
  • Sort mail and packages and distribute to mailboxes 
  • Secure documents for leases 
  • Input meter readings 
  • Contact maintenance when needed for guests with any potential problems 
  • Performs other related duties as assigned
